We are looking for an Editor to join the team for the re-launch of our Business Chief brand as part of our growing portfolio of B2B publications. This is a role that covers daily web articles, monthly digital magazines and multimedia content. Reporting to the Editor-in-Chief of Business Chief, this role will also work across our portfolio of titles in the sector, including HR Chief, Finance Chief, Sports Chief, Legal Chief and Marketing Chief.
How does the day-to-day look?
- Sourcing and writing daily web content for a global audience
- Researching and delivering content for the magazine
- Assisting the digital marketing team with social media accounts
- Writing commercial features with high-end clients based on interviews
- National and international travel to relevant industry events
- Travel to interviews to assist the video production team
Core Skills
- Strong writer with keen news sense, and able to write to a house style
- Proven experience in B2B writing with senior executives
- Attention to detail: proofreading magazines before they are published and assisting other brand editors in quality control
- A degree in journalism or similar
- A minimum of two years’ experience in content and editorial writing
- Knowledge of SEO best practices
- Exceptional organisational skills and ability to work in a fast-paced and deadline-driven environment
